Swell. What else was going to go wrong on this trip?

Alec came to this planet looking to make earth’s first alien encounter.

He had found an alien spacecraft and even made contact with what he thought were lost aliens.

Unfortunately, they did not let him in on their little secret about their own alien enemy.
Now he seemed to be in the middle of an interstellar war.

If they did not get him, the local wild life would.

On top of that, the jump gate did not work and his lander was lying on its side.

Now he was stuck somewhere at the edge of space and the only help he had was a computer with a personality problem.
 

This is not how he envisioned galactic exploration.

His new alien contacts were apparently unaware these other aliens were in the area.

Now his mission had become one of rescue for his new found friends.

There was just one big problem.

Who was going to rescue him?
